On 8/23/26 10:01 PM, Guopeng Zhang wrote: > From: Guopeng Zhang <[email protected]> > > check_isolcpus() clears ISOLCPUS before rebuilding it from sched domain > data. Comparing that empty value with > /sys/devices/system/cpu/isolated makes the test fail whenever > isolcpus=domain is present. > > That sysfs file is generated from HK_TYPE_DOMAIN_BOOT and does not change > when cpuset updates HK_TYPE_DOMAIN. Re-reading it cannot validate dynamic > housekeeping updates. The cpuset.cpus.isolated and sched domain checks > already cover the two dynamic interfaces, so remove the invalid comparison. > > This can be reproduced on a kernel booted with isolcpus=domain,15: > > # tools/testing/selftests/cgroup/test_cpuset_prs.sh > > The test fails its first state-matrix isolation check before the change and > continues past that check afterward. > > Fixes: 6df415aa46ec ("cgroup/cpuset: Defer housekeeping_update() calls from CPU hotplug to workqueue") > Signed-off-by: Guopeng Zhang <[email protected]> > --- > tools/testing/selftests/cgroup/test_cpuset_prs.sh | 6 ------ > 1 file changed, 6 deletions(-) > > diff --git a/tools/testing/selftests/cgroup/test_cpuset_prs.sh b/tools/testing/selftests/cgroup/test_cpuset_prs.sh > index da8f7b920178..fdb3185570d4 100755 > --- a/tools/testing/selftests/cgroup/test_cpuset_prs.sh > +++ b/tools/testing/selftests/cgroup/test_cpuset_prs.sh > @@ -797,7 +797,6 @@ check_isolcpus() > EXPECTED_ISOLCPUS=$1 > ISCPUS=${CGROUP2}/cpuset.cpus.isolated > ISOLCPUS=$(cat $ISCPUS) > - HKICPUS=$(cat /sys/devices/system/cpu/isolated) > LASTISOLCPU= > SCHED_DOMAINS=/sys/kernel/debug/sched/domains > if [[ $EXPECTED_ISOLCPUS = . ]] > @@ -835,11 +834,6 @@ check_isolcpus() > ISOLCPUS= > EXPECTED_ISOLCPUS=$EXPECTED_SDOMAIN > > - # > - # The inverse of HK_TYPE_DOMAIN cpumask in $HKICPUS should match $ISOLCPUS > - # > - [[ "$ISOLCPUS" != "$HKICPUS" ]] && return 1 > - > # > # Use the sched domain in debugfs to check isolated CPUs, if available > # The /sys/devices/system/cpu/isolated had recently be changed to report the boot time isolcpus=domain value. So the check is no longer valid and should be removed. Of course the position of the check is also problematic. So it should be removed. Reviewed-by: Waiman Long <[email protected]>
